Doomben Racecourse is set to come alive on Wednesday, June 18, 2025, with a thrilling eight-race card hosted by the Brisbane Racing Club. Midweek racing in Brisbane continues to attract attention for its competitive fields and vibrant trackside atmosphere, and this edition promises to be no different.
The action begins at 12:33 PM with the Become A BRC Member Maiden Plate, run over 2070 meters and offering a $40,000 prize purse. This staying event features a field of eight: Lucifer The Cat, Ormond Road, Prefer To Dance, Show ‘Em Norm, So Suave, State Of Affairs, Kalbar Queen, and Zoublime. With fresh talent and improving stayers in the mix, this opener sets a compelling tone for the day.
Following that is the Tattersall’s Tiara Raceday 28 June QTIS 3YO Maiden Plate at 1:08 PM, covering 1660 meters, also for $40,000. Nine up-and-coming three-year-olds will line up: Cambridge Bay, Dream Thinker, Gas Brigade, Ludwig, Easy Love, Kaddari, Lune D’excellence, Saturdays Girl, and Xtra La Vita. Many eyes will be on this race as it serves as a key form guide for the upcoming Tattersall’s Tiara meeting.
The third race, scheduled for 1:43 PM, is the Mekka Raceday 16 August QTIS 2YO Handicap. A shorter sprint over 1350 meters, it carries $38,000 in prize money. Among the juveniles looking to make a statement are North Pole, Artistic Endeavour, First Empire, Zhongxin Koala, Lockyer, Straz Danz, and Saveur. Promising young talent will be on full display.
At 2:18 PM, speed will take centre stage in the Gold Maiden Handicap, run over 1110 meters for $40,000. This quick dash features Barberry Spur, Yoyo Yeezy, Deep Vegas, Out Of Turn, Rosso Levanto, Deep Tiara, Equine Art, Final Voyage, and Shaque D’amour. Expect an explosive finish in this tightly packed sprint.
The Mullins Lawyers Class 3 Handicap follows at 2:53 PM, stretching over 1660 meters with $38,000 on the line. It boasts a large and competitive field of 15: Zou Big Boy, Flywheel, Warrant, Diana’s Affair, Miss Chenery, Rashford, Regal Edition, Addition, Pireonti, El Pensador, Adelad, Treasurer, Tambourine Man, Ambassadors, and Mootessa. With form horses and improving runners, it could prove to be the most strategic race of the day.
Race six, the QCF Charity Raceday 19 July Class 1 Handicap, takes place at 3:28 PM over 1200 meters, offering $38,000 in prize money. Horses such as Make A Call, Starsonus, King Boom, Facundo, Fourandahalf, Better Be Ready, Bit Of Grunt, Retainer, Velozes, Hey Chardonnay, Champonnet, Dashing Hope, Rockrata, and Jediah will battle it out for supremacy in what promises to be a fast-paced contest.
The penultimate event is the Sky Racing BM70 Handicap at 4:03 PM, covering 1350 meters for $38,000. This evenly matched field includes Itza Charmdeel, Tara Jasmine, Starry Eyes, Boondocks, Fat Fingers, Lumens Lenny, Cracker Essgee, Lovewillcomelater, Affinity Flyer, Treasurer, and Headhunter. With benchmark ratings tightly grouped, this race should go right down to the wire.
Bringing the day to a close is a Handicap race over 1110 meters at 4:34 PM, featuring He’s Heaven, Defiant Spirit, Emperor, Caspernova, Simbu, Thelwell, Charming Nic, Femme Fatale, and Eye Pea Oh. With sprinters looking to end the meeting on a high note, the finale is sure to entertain.
Racegoers will be able to enjoy both live trackside action and interstate races displayed on large screens around the venue. Gates open at 11:45 AM, giving patrons time to settle in for what promises to be an enjoyable and action-packed midweek outing.
